  • 简单网络编程TCP SERVER 端

    一个服务器,接受客户连接,返回客户IP地址,并关闭连接。

    一个服务器程序的基本步骤:
    1. winsock library 的初始化
    2. 创建socket
    3. 服务器地址
    4. bind->listen
    5. 等待客户连接 accept
    6. 处理客户接入
    7. 关闭 socket
    8. 释放资源:winsock library

    // SimpleTcpServer.cpp : Defines the entry point for the console application.
    //

    #include  "stdafx.h"
    #include  <winsock2.h>
    #pragma comment(lib, "ws2_32" )
    #include  "SimpleTcpServer.h"

    #include  <conio.h>

    #ifdef _DEBUG
    #define  new  DEBUG_NEW
    #undef THIS_FILE
    static  char  THIS_FILE[] = __FILE__ ;
    #endif

    /////////////////////////////////////////////////////////////////////////////
    // The one and only application object
    //z 2011-05-22 21:23:03@is2120

    CWinApp theApp;

    using  namespace  std;

    UINT  ServerThread(LPVOID pParam);

    int  _tmain(int  argc, TCHAR* argv[], TCHAR* envp[])
    {
      int  nRetCode = 0 ;

      // initialize MFC and print and error on failure
      if  (!AfxWinInit(::GetModuleHandle(NULL ), NULL , ::GetCommandLine(), 0 ))
      {
        //  TODO : change error code to suit your needs
        cerr << _T("Fatal Error: MFC initialization failed" ) << endl;
        nRetCode = 1 ;
      }
      else
      {
        //  TODO : code your application's behavior here.
        /*
        CString strHello;
        strHello.LoadString(IDS_HELLO);
        cout << (LPCTSTR)strHello << endl;
         */
        int  nRetCode = 0
        
        cout << "Press ESCAPE to terminate program /r/n " ;
        AfxBeginThread(ServerThread,0 );
        while (_getch()!=27 );
        
        return  nRetCode;
      }

      return  nRetCode;
    }

    UINT  ServerThread(LPVOID pParam)

        cout << "Starting up TCP server /r/n " ;

        //A SOCKET is simply a typedef for an unsigned int.

        //In Unix, socket handles were just about same as file 

        //handles which were again unsigned ints.

        //Since this cannot be entirely true under Windows

        //a new data type called SOCKET was defined.

        SOCKET server;

        //WSADATA is a struct that is filled up by the call 

        //to WSAStartup

        WSADATA wsaData;

        //The sockaddr_in specifies the address of the socket

        //for TCP/IP sockets. Other protocols use similar structures.

        sockaddr_in local;

        //WSAStartup initializes the program for calling WinSock.

        //The first parameter specifies the highest version of the 

        //WinSock specification, the program is allowed to use.

        int  wsaret=WSAStartup(0x101 ,&wsaData);

        //WSAStartup returns zero on success.

        //If it fails we exit.

        if (wsaret!=0 )
        {
            return  0 ;
        }

        //Now we populate the sockaddr_in structure

        local.sin_family=AF_INET; //Address family

        local.sin_addr.s_addr=INADDR_ANY; //Wild card IP address

        local.sin_port=htons((u_short)20248 ); //port to use

        //the socket function creates our SOCKET

        server=socket(AF_INET,SOCK_STREAM,0 );

        //If the socket() function fails we exit

        if (server==INVALID_SOCKET)
        {
            return  0 ;
        }

        //bind links the socket we just created with the sockaddr_in 

        //structure. Basically it connects the socket with 

        //the local address and a specified port.

        //If it returns non-zero quit, as this indicates error

        if (bind(server,(sockaddr*)&local,sizeof (local))!=0 )
        {
            return  0 ;
        }

        //listen instructs the socket to listen for incoming 

        //connections from clients. The second arg is the backlog

        if (listen(server,10 )!=0 )
        {
            return  0 ;
        }

        //we will need variables to hold the client socket.

        //thus we declare them here.

        SOCKET client;
        sockaddr_in from;
        int  fromlen=sizeof (from);

        while (true )//we are looping endlessly

        {
            char  temp[512 ];

            //accept() will accept an incoming

            //client connection

            client=accept(server,
                (struct  sockaddr*)&from,&fromlen);
        
            sprintf(temp,"Your IP is  %s /r/n " ,inet_ntoa(from.sin_addr));

            //we simply send this string to the client

            send(client,temp,strlen(temp),0 );
            cout << "Connection from "  << inet_ntoa(from.sin_addr) <<" /r/n " ;
        
            //close the client socket

            closesocket(client);

        }

        //closesocket() closes the socket and releases the socket descriptor

        closesocket(server);

        //originally this function probably had some use

        //currently this is just for backward compatibility

        //but it is safer to call it as I still believe some

        //implementations use this to terminate use of WS2_32.DLL 

        WSACleanup();

        return  0 ;
    }
